Evaluando propuestas

Zeroonze.

Publicado el 04 Julio, 2025 en Programación y Tecnología

Sobre este proyecto

Abierto

Olá!

Estamos iniciando o desenvolvimento do ZeroOnze Run, um aplicativo mobile focado em corredores de rua. A ideia é criar uma plataforma all-in-one que una inscrições em corridas, check-in via QR Code, gamificação, integração com Strava/Garmin e um pequeno marketplace esportivo.

Abaixo, os requisitos principais para a primeira versão (MVP):

Funcionalidades essenciais do MVP:
Cadastro e Login

Autenticação via e-mail, Google e Apple.

Perfis de usuário com dados básicos.

Busca e inscrição em eventos

Tela com lista de torneios/corridas (virtuais e presenciais).

Filtro por local, data e distância.

Inscrição direta via app.

Sistema de pagamento

Integração com métodos como Pix, cartão e boleto.

Emissão de QR Code para check-in.

Check-in via QR Code

Leitura e validação do QR Code no dia do evento.

Registro da presença em banco de dados.

Dashboard básico para organizadores

Visualizar inscritos e participantes presentes.

Relatório simples de presença e engajamento.

Integração com Strava e Garmin

Sincronização de dados pós-prova (tempo, pace).

Envio de brinde

Sistema para gerar ordem/envio de camiseta para inscritos (podemos começar manualmente).

Tecnologia:
Frontend Mobile: Flutter ou React Native (você pode sugerir a melhor opção).

Backend: Node.js com NestJS

Banco de Dados: PostgreSQL + Firebase para dados em tempo real.

Integrações: Strava API, Mercado Pago (ou similar), Firebase Auth.

Contexto general del proyecto

Olá! Estamos iniciando o desenvolvimento do ZeroOnze Run, um aplicativo mobile focado em corredores de rua. A ideia é criar uma plataforma all-in-one que una inscrições em corridas, check-in via QR Code, gamificação, integração com Strava/Garmin e um pequeno marketplace esportivo. Abaixo, os requisitos principais para a primeira versão (MVP): Funcionalidades essenciais do MVP: Cadastro e Login Autenticação via e-mail, Google e Apple. Perfis de usuário com dados básicos. Busca e inscrição em eventos Tela com lista de torneios/corridas (virtuais e presenciais). Filtro por local, data e distância. Inscrição direta via app. Sistema de pagamento Integração com métodos como Pix, cartão e boleto. Emissão de QR Code para check-in. Check-in via QR Code Leitura e validação do QR Code no dia do evento. Registro da presença em banco de dados. Dashboard básico para organizadores Visualizar inscritos e participantes presentes. Relatório simples de presença e engajamento. Integração com Strava e Garmin Sincronização de dados pós-prova (tempo, pace). Envio de brinde Sistema para gerar ordem/envio de camiseta para inscritos (podemos começar manualmente). Tecnologia: Frontend Mobile: Flutter ou React Native (você pode sugerir a melhor opção). Backend: Node.js com NestJS Banco de Dados: PostgreSQL + Firebase para dados em tempo real. Integrações: Strava API, Mercado Pago (ou similar), Firebase Auth.

Categoría Programación y Tecnología
Subcategoría Programación Web
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o Tengo una idea
Disponibilidad requerida Tiempo completo
Integraciones de API Payment Processor (Paypal, Stripe, etc.), Social media (Facebook, Twitter, etc.), Otros (Otras APIs)
Roles necesarios Programador

Duración del proyecto 1 a 3 meses

Habilidades necesarias